The dealership is not shady just because they are using the Daewoo name that they paid $200,000 for, to soon discover that the president stole BILLIONS of dollars from the company, causing Daewoo to go bankrupt.
I bought a Daewoo Lanos when they first were available in Canada. I've got to say, it was the best car I've had. No problems. Sporty looking and it had its own version of Honda vTech (Etech). The only reason I sold my Daewoo was because I knew it would be next to impossible to find parts after GM bought Daewoo's factories and parts inventory.
Now, if they are shady for reasons other than this, this I don't know. But why they still keep up that sign is because they paid a ton of money for the dealership name and thats all they have to show for it. Just thought I'd give people an explanation of why you still see Daewoo signs still up at dealerships.
